Output 7dd63206e5c285e862fce4114fd7b08e7da329c2eadbb10ce5ecc36034181db9:3

value
703463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4ffa1ca88a20fe86818891c3e4b11a9136c6e6d OP_EQUAL
address
3NZrDuMxuWZbNE3dav9htwUwUD8YkSVHSe
transaction
7dd63206e5c285e862fce4114fd7b08e7da329c2eadbb10ce5ecc36034181db9
spent
true